Long-Term Rentals Are Taking Over

While short-term rentals (STRs) were once the golden ticket in Dubai, 2025 shows a dramatic shift toward long-term leasing. With the growing influx of expats seeking stability, many tenants are opting for 12–24 month rental contracts instead of transient Airbnb-style stays.


Why it matters for landlords:

  • Long-term tenants = reduced vacancy periods.

  • Lower turnover = fewer maintenance and marketing costs.

  • Greater opportunity to build tenant relationships.

💡 Tip: Consider offering incentives like a free month’s rent or flexible payment terms to attract high-quality long-term renters.


🏢 2. Smart Homes Are a Top Rental Trend in Dubai

Gone are the days when Wi-Fi was enough. Today’s tenants want smart-enabled apartments — from keyless entry and automated lighting to energy-efficient climate control.


🎯 A recent study reveals that properties with smart home features lease 35% faster and attract tech-savvy tenants willing to pay a premium.


Integrate features like:

  • Smart thermostats (e.g., Nest)

  • Smart locks and security systems

  • Automated lighting & curtain systems

  • Voice-activated assistants (Alexa, Google Home)



🌍 3. Sustainability is More Than a Buzzword

As Dubai’s real estate sector leans toward green buildings, tenants are actively seeking eco-friendly rentals in 2025. Sustainability isn’t just about saving the planet — it’s a key differentiator in the rental market.


Tenants now evaluate:

  • DEWA (electricity/water) consumption

  • Use of energy-efficient appliances

  • Green certifications (LEED, Estidama)


📌 Landlords who invest in green upgrades can increase rental value by up to 10%, and properties often lease faster due to growing environmental awareness.

🧳 5. Fully Furnished Units Dominate

Furnished apartments are not just for tourists anymore. Expats, remote workers, and digital nomads are driving up the demand for turnkey living spaces.


Key trends include:

  • Scandinavian and minimalist furniture styles

  • High-speed internet, TVs, and kitchen appliances included

  • Work-from-home ready setups


💡 Pro Tip: Invest in durable, stylish furniture and modern appliances to command higher rent.


💼 6. Professional Tenants & Remote Workers are Changing the Game

In 2025, Dubai’s tenant pool includes a growing number of remote workers, consultants, and entrepreneurs. These tenants prioritize:


  • Fast internet

  • Peaceful locations

  • Co-working spaces nearby

  • Flexible contracts


📍 Areas like Business Bay, JVC, and Dubai Hills are popular among this demographic. Target your marketing accordingly to attract high-paying, low-maintenance tenants.


💸 7. Flexible Rent Payment Plans Are In Demand

Tenants in 2025 prefer monthly or quarterly rental payments over the outdated one-cheque system. In fact, landlords offering flexible payment terms enjoy:


  • Faster occupancy

  • Reduced negotiation resistance

  • Stronger tenant loyalty


🏦 Digital wallets and online transfer options are also gaining traction, thanks to Dubai’s shift towards a cashless economy.

🏙️ 9. Suburban Zones are Heating Up

While Downtown Dubai and Marina remain hot, suburban areas like Damac Hills, Town Square, and Mirdif are attracting families and long-term residents in search of space and affordability.

Reasons include:


  • New schools and hospitals

  • Better parking and green space

  • Lower rents with more square footage


🏠 As a landlord, investing in these zones can offer higher yields and longer-term stability.
